Damien Mc Anespie ★★★★☆
My first time here and also my first time experiencing a movie in IMAX format (Tron Ares) which was thoroughly enjoyable. Very clean cinema and friendly/helpful staff throughout. Yes tickets + food are expensive but no surprises there. However, the most disappointing part of it all was a full 31mins of adverts/ trailers which began at the time the movie was due to begin, completely inexcusable .... surely there is some sort of rules/ policy around this Cineworld?? Free car parking ticket appreciated but given I live 1hr from Belfast, this cinema experience will only be used for special occasions only.

Amc media ★★★★★
Very modern cinema. Photos taken around 2pm midweek. Very clean cinema with friendly staff. Prices are what you'd expect for any other cinema. The chairs recline and there's plenty of room between the seats infront and behind. Good sound as well, not too loud or quiet. Plenty of toilets near all the screens. In terms of food, there's popcorn, ice cream, bagged sweets, nachos, hotdogs and pick a mix. There's also a lavazza cafe right beside the cinema so you can get a coffee before your movie. Overall great experience, I'd say it looks worlds apart from Odeon, Omniplex, etc, but prices are all still similar.
